The Computational Biology tasks of the project include:

- generation of 3D structure models of Plasmodium proteins involved in epigenetic regulation, by homology modeling;
- comparison of the structures against human proteins, and search for parasite specific inhibitors by docking studies
- identification of probable sequence and structural motifs/domains accounting for protein substrate specificity in the parasite, and
- development of a tool for prediction of protein families and motifs in Plasmodium species and other related apicomplexan parasites.
